In this video, we explore a new feature introduced in the latest builds of batocera 43: PlayStation 3 ISO support with RPCS3.

Thanks to a recent update of the RPCS3 emulator, it is now possible to boot PS3 games directly from ISO images. This makes managing your game library much easier compared to extracted game folders.

However, there is one important detail: RPCS3 only works with decrypted ISO images. Most PlayStation 3 disc dumps, especially those following the Redump standard, are encrypted by default.

In this tutorial, I will show you:
• How PS3 ISO support works on batocera
• Why Redump ISO images need to be decrypted
• How to use a simple tool directly on batocera to decrypt your PS3 ISO images
